Output dd33b1d4ec001575ba3755697dad907f209e2d73a9c8d4f87ce6db59cdc240a4:0

value
558716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ea3d5b5085091024c171b9d96a4fc8a27783ab0 OP_EQUAL
address
3HcRmN2J4QcvdFUxTiqDm4DJEKC3FhKtTK
transaction
dd33b1d4ec001575ba3755697dad907f209e2d73a9c8d4f87ce6db59cdc240a4
confirmations
380785
spent
true